Internal memo — for the incoming director. Our pilot with the Bramleigh Stores chain has run for eleven weeks across six locations in the Kestwick region. Sell-through of the Oriel snack range is 18% above projection, though restocking lead times remain a friction point. Bramleigh's merchandising team has asked about extending the pilot to their northern cluster. A decision on scope is needed before month end. The confidential planning note is attached immediately below.

confidential, fahag-yahap: Project Raleth slips by six weeks because of the tooling delay.

// SQLLINT_RULESET_VERSION pins the rule set Quartzquill applies to all
// .sql files before merge. Support team: if a customer's migration fails
// lint unexpectedly, check this version first — rules tightened around
// unqualified DELETE statements recently. The ruleset is validated per
// build, and the verifying token sits just below.

trace token, fafog-kageg: htk4_98e6

## Changelog: Setting Renamed

`RELOAD_INTERVAL` is now `HOTSWAP_POLL_SECS` in Brindlecast 4.2. Config hot-reloads every poll cycle; no restart needed. Old name is ignored silently, so update your env files now. The watcher also re-reads credentials on each cycle, which means your local file needs the signing secret defined on the next line.

secret setting of kahif-bagep: VAULT_KEY29=2dc5e8284b5a3e9e278f4ba0906fc

## Sorting Stability in Gridform Reports

Plugin authors should note that Gridform's report builder guarantees stable sorting: rows with equal keys retain their insertion order across all column sorts. If your plugin injects rows mid-pipeline, preserve the `_seq` field or stability breaks silently. To publish a sorting extension to the Gridform registry, sign your bundle with the current deploy key shown here.

deploy key for kajof-fajop: bky6_gDHw9Q

- [ ] **Step 7: Breaker override escrow.** After sealing the signing keys for the Tallgrove upstream API circuit breaker, confirm the support team can force the breaker open during a full outage. The override bundle lives in the sealed escrow drawer and is useless without its unlock phrase. Two ceremony witnesses must initial this step before proceeding. The escrow bundle is decrypted with the recovery passphrase that follows.

vault phrase of kahip-kahop = holath-quenmir